Hawkeyes Propelled By Second Round in Chattanooga

CHATTANOOGA, Tenn. – The University of Iowa women’s golf team sits in second place at the Chattanooga Classic at Black Creek Club after two rounds.

The 36-hole team total of 594 (+18) was highlighted by the second round score of 285 (-3) which is the second lowest Iowa single round team score this season. 285 is the lowest single round team total in this tournament, with the next closest being Chattanooga’s second-round 293. The Hawkeyes are four shots behind leaders East Tennessee State (590, +14) heading into the final round on Tuesday.

Three Hawkeyes rank in the top 10 of the tournament individual leaderboard. Sophomore Morgan Goldstein is in third (142, -2), freshman Klara Wildhaber is in fourth (146, +2), and sophomore Jacque Galloway is tied for eighth (149, +5). Goldstein and Wildhaber both shot a career low 69 in the second round, and they are tied atop the leaderboard for “Par 4 Scoring”, averaging a 3.95. As a team, Iowa has shot the best on Par 4s in the tournament, averaging 4.16, and they have 22 birdies so far.

Junior Manuela Lizarazu is tied for 42nd after shooting a 157 (+13), and sophomore Lea Zeitler sits in a tie for 52nd after her 161 (+17) in the first two rounds.

The Hawkeyes continue the final round of the Chattanooga Classic on Tuesday, starting at 7 a.m. (CT).
